The Hayti Heritage Cultural Center in Durham, NC, is dedicated to preserving and advancing the heritage and culture of historic Hayti and the African American experience. Through a diverse array of programs, events, and exhibitions, Hayti serves as a vital hub for cultural enrichment and artistic education, fostering community engagement and understanding.
Offering everything from dance and drumming classes to poetry slams and art exhibitions, Hayti is committed to providing a space where local artists and the community can connect and thrive. With a rich history and a vibrant future, the center stands as a cultural icon, celebrating the legacy of its past while embracing contemporary artistic expression.
